reteach or practice resource for math standard 1.nbt.c.4
This learning resource focuses on understanding addition with tens and ones using visual aids like blocks and number lines. The document provides step-by-step instructions for adding two-digit numbers by breaking them down into tens and ones. It begins with basic examples like 24 + 13, explaining how to add the tens and ones separately to arrive at the total. The resource also encourages students to practice by drawing base-ten blocks and using a place value chart for additions such as 23 + 45 and 51 + 36. It includes exercises to solidify understanding of the addition process involving both small and larger numbers.
